Coming in at No. 15 is '26 Hudson Devaughan (Mooresville HS). A 6-foot-4, 195-pound right-handed pitcher. Devaughan offered loud looks throughout the spring and summer after a solid showing at the Preseason All-State in March. The righty sat in the low 90s throughout the year and even managed to touch 95 mph in-game. Devaughan had a 2.05 earned run average in high school ball for the Mooresville Pioneers, striking-out 56 in 30.2 innings pitched. The Alabama recruit is currently ranked #4 in the 2026 class and #49 in the country.

Scouting Report
The sophomore class' top-ranked prospect - Devaughan showed a powerful fastball at the All-State with tons of upside for continued development. Up to 94 mph at previous events this winter, Devaughan averaged 92.2 mph on his four-seam fastball, carrying it with 16" of IVB. The 6-foot-4, 195 pounder also showed a 91-92 mph sinker with 15" of horizontal break. Devaughan will be able to bully hitters with two advanced heaters, and he spun a slurvey, 77-81 mph breaking ball that worked with two-plane shape and spun tightly (2500). The Alabama recruit was inconsistent with command in this look, particularly with his offspeed, but there is no denying the upside he has as a future mid-to-upper 90s arm.
Position Profile: RHP/OF
Body: 6-2, 160-pounds. Projectable frame
Delivery: Consistent tempo throughout the delivery. Athletic balance point, controlled move down the slope, square landing, balanced and athletic finish.
Arm Action: RH. Electric arm. Clean arm action, ball jumps out of the hand from an OTT slot.
FB: T90, 89-90 mph. Fastball with serious life. T2518, 2355 average rpm.
CB: 76-78 mph. Wipeout action at times - will be a plus pitch. T2518, 2446 average rpm.
CH: 77-81 mph. Some feel w/ some sink. T2344, 1769 average rpm.
